body { width: 1200px; margin: 0 auto; background: url(img/tlo1.jpg) repeat-x #1c1c1c; font-size: 11px; font-family: Tahoma,Verdana; color: white; margin-top: 58px; }
img { border: 0; text-decoration: none; }
a { border: 0; text-decoration: none; color: #D6D6D6; }
a:hover { text-decoration: underline; }

a#logo { background: url(img/logo.jpg) no-repeat; float: left; display: block; width: 618px; height: 209px; }
.panel-logowania { float: left; height: 209px; width: 582px; }
.panel-logowania-bg { line-height: 10px; background: url(img/panel-logowania-bg.jpg) no-repeat; float: left; width: 562px; height: 151px; padding-top: 11px; color: white; font-size: 11px; padding-left: 20px; }
.panel-logowania a { color: #f0b502; font-weight: bold; }
.panel-logowania a:hover { color: lime; }
.login-input { float: left; background: url(img/login-input.jpg) no-repeat; width: 180px; height: 23px; color: #767676; border: 0; padding-top: 5px; padding-left: 67px; text-align: left; margin-right: 10px; }
.haslo-input { float: left; background: url(img/haslo-input.jpg) no-repeat; width: 180px; height: 23px; color: #767676; border: 0; padding-top: 5px; padding-left: 67px; text-align: left; margin-right: 10px; margin-top: 10px; }
.all { width: 1098px; margin: 0 auto; }

.menu { width: 1098px; height: 35px; float: left; }
.menu ul { list-style: none; margin: 0; float: left; width: 640px; height: 33px; background: url('menu/menu_bg.jpg');}
.menu ul a { display: block; display: inline; position: relative; color: #C4C4C4; display: block; font-size: 12px; font-family: Arial;}
.menu ul a:hover {text-decoration: none;}
.menu li { float: left; padding: 10px 3px 0px 3px; text-align: center; height: 15px; overflow: hidden; position: relative;}
.menu li a { display: block;}
.menu li div { background: #000000; position: relative; text-align: left; padding: 5px; z-index: 300;}
.szybki-kontakt { background: url(img/szybki-kontakt.jpg) no-repeat; width: 257px; height: 17px; float: left; padding-left: 4px; padding-top: 16px; color: #808080; }

.tlo { background: url(img/tlo.jpg) repeat-y; width: 1098px; float: left; padding-top: 10px; }
.top1 { width: 1098px; float: left; height: 156px; }

.rotator_bg { width: 405px; height: 156px; float: left; z-index: 0; }
.rotator-przyciski { background: url(img/rotator-przyciski.jpg) no-repeat; width: 142px; height: 17px; float: left; padding-top: 15px; }
.rotator-przyciski ul { list-style: none; padding: 0; margin: 0; }
.rotator-przyciski li { float: left; margin-left: 2px; }
.rotator-bg { width: 405px; height: 122px; overflow: hidden; float: left;  position: relative;}
.rotator a { display: block; position: absolute; bottom: 0; left: 0; width: 395px; height: 20px; font-size: 12px; z-index: 100; color: #111111; background: #979797; font-weight: bold; padding: 5px; opacity: 0.6; -moz-opacity: 0.6; filter: Alpha(Opacity=60); }
.rotator a:hover { text-decoration: none; }
.rotator { display: none; overflow: hidden; width: 405px; height: 122px; position: relative; }

.ostatnie a { color: white; position: relative; }
.ostatnie dfn { display: none; width: 200px; position: absolute; font-weight: bold; left: 0; top: 20px; padding: 5px; margin: 0; text-align: center; border: 1px solid #666666; border-left: 5px solid #3c3c3c; color: #000000; background: #a1a1a1; z-index: 100; }
.ostatnie a:hover { margin-left: 5px; }
.ostatnie a:hover dfn { display: block; margin: 0; }
.ostatnie-newsy { width: 201px; height: 156px; float: left; }
.ostatnie-newsy-top { width: 161px; height: 26px; float: left; background: url('img/ostatnie-newsy.jpg'); font-family: Arial; font-size: 12px; font-weight: bold; font-style: italic; padding: 22px 0px 0px 40px;}
.ostatnie-newsy-bg { float: left; background: url(img/ostatnie-newsy-bg.jpg) no-repeat; width: 171px; height: 108px;padding-left: 30px; }
.ostatnie-newsy-bg ul { list-style: url(img/k.jpg) inside; margin: 0; padding: 0; }
.ostatnie-newsy-bg li { margin-top: 6px; }
.ostatnie-spotkania { width: 185px; height: 156px; float: left; }
.ostatnie-spotkania-top { width: 165px; height: 26px; float: left; background: url('img/ostatnie-spotkania.jpg'); font-family: Arial; font-size: 12px; font-weight: bold; font-style: italic; padding: 22px 0px 0px 20px;}
.ostatnie-spotkania-bg { float: left; background: url(img/ostatnie-spotkania-bg.jpg) no-repeat; width: 175px; height: 108px; padding-left: 10px; }
.ostatnie-spotkania-bg ul { list-style: none; padding: 0; margin: 0; }
.ostatnie-spotkania-bg li { margin-top: 6px; }
.ostatnie-pliki { width: 237px; height: 156px; float: left; }
.ostatnie-pliki-top { width: 207px; height: 22px; float: left; background: url('img/ostatnie-pliki.jpg'); font-family: Arial; font-size: 12px; font-weight: bold; font-style: italic; padding: 26px 0px 0px 30px;}
.ostatnie-pliki-bg { float: left; background: url(img/ostatnie-pliki-bg.jpg) no-repeat; width: 207px; height: 108px; padding-left: 30px; }
.ostatnie-pliki-bg ul { list-style: url(img/folder.jpg) inside; padding: 0; margin: 0; }
.ostatnie-pliki-bg li { margin-top: 6px; }
.panel-top { width: 206px; height: 17px; float: left; margin-top: 5px; background: url('img/panel-top.jpg'); font-family: Verdana; font-size: 10px; color: #D5D5D5; padding: 10px 0px 0px 10px;}

.lewa { width: 560px; float: left; margin-left: 26px; margin-top: 10px; }
.news-ticker { float: left; color: #cccccc; background: url(img/news-ticker.jpg) no-repeat; width: 458px; height: 19px; padding-left: 82px; padding-right: 20px; font-family: Verdana,Tahoma; font-size: 10px; padding-top: 9px; }

.news { margin-top: 10px; float: left; font-family: Verdana,Tahoma; font-size: 11px; }
.lewa-gora { margin-top: 10px; float: left; font-family: Verdana,Tahoma; font-size: 11px; color: white; }

.belka-gora { width: 430px; height: 41px; background: url(img/belka-gora.jpg) no-repeat; float: left; padding-top: 10px; padding-left: 10px; color: #979797; font-size: 10px; }
.news-tresc { color: #b6b6b6; float: left; padding-left: 7px; padding-right: 7px; }
.news-tresc:first-letter { font-size: 14px; }
.belka-gora a { font-weight: bold; color: #979797; }
.tytul { color: #ffc000; font-weight: bold; font-size: 13px; }

.srodek { width: 216px; float: left; margin-left: 15px; margin-top: 10px; }
.t-tlo { background: url(img/srodek-tlo.jpg) repeat-y; width: 196px; float: left; padding: 10px 10px 10px 10px; text-align: center; color: #d6d6d6; }
.t-tlo ul { list-style: none; margin: 0; padding: 0; text-align: left; }
.t-tlo li { border-bottom: dashed 1px #4c4c4c; padding-left: 7px; margin-top: 4px; }
.t-tlo a { color: #9f9f9f; }
.t-tlo a:hover { color: aqua; }
.prawa { width: 216px; margin-left: 15px; float: left; margin-top: 10px; }
.stopka { width: 1061px; height: 166px; background: url(img/stopka.jpg) no-repeat; float:left; text-align: left; color: #9f9f9f; padding-left: 37px; }
